Modular Buildings and Their Many Purposes

Modular buildings have become increasingly popular over the years, as they offer a cost-effective and efficient solution for construction projects. These buildings are prefabricated in a factory, and then transported to the construction site where they are assembled. They are designed to be used for a wide range of purposes, including commercial, industrial, educational, and residential applications.

Modular buildings are built using a variety of materials, including wood, steel, and concrete. They are designed to be lightweight, yet sturdy enough to withstand harsh weather conditions and heavy use. The modules are usually built to standard sizes, which allows for easy transportation and assembly on site. These buildings are customizable, and can be designed to meet the specific needs of the client.

The modular construction process begins with the design phase. The client works with a team of architects and engineers to create a design that meets their needs and budget. The design is then translated into a set of plans and specifications, which are used to manufacture the modular units. The modules are built in a factory, where they are constructed using quality materials and precise manufacturing techniques.

Once the modules are completed, they are transported to the construction site. The transportation process varies depending on the size and weight of the modules, as well as the distance they need to travel. In some cases, the modules are transported by truck, while in other cases they may be transported by rail or barge.

Once the modules arrive on site, they are assembled by a team of skilled workers. The modules are connected using bolts and other fasteners, and the building is completed by installing the roof, siding, and other finishing touches. The assembly process can take anywhere from a few days to a few weeks, depending on the size and complexity of the building.

One of the main advantages of modular buildings is their cost-effectiveness. Because they are manufactured in a factory, they can be produced more quickly and efficiently than traditional construction methods. This results in lower labor costs, which translates into lower overall construction costs. Additionally, because the modules are built to standard sizes, there is less waste during the manufacturing process, which further reduces costs.

Modular buildings are also very flexible, and can be easily expanded or reconfigured as the needs of the client change. This makes them an ideal solution for companies and organizations that anticipate future growth or changes in their operations. The modular design also allows for easy disassembly and relocation, which makes them a great option for temporary or mobile buildings.

Another advantage of modular buildings is their environmental sustainability. Because the modules are manufactured in a factory, there is less waste produced during the manufacturing process.

Additionally, because the modules are designed to be transported, there is less energy used during transportation. Modular buildings can also be designed to be energy-efficient, with features such as high-efficiency HVAC systems and insulation.

Modular buildings are used for a wide range of purposes, including offices, schools, hospitals, retail spaces, and even homes. In the commercial and industrial sectors, modular buildings are often used for temporary offices, storage facilities, and manufacturing plants. They are also used for retail spaces, such as pop-up shops and temporary stores.

In the education sector, modular buildings are used for classrooms, libraries, and administrative offices. Modular buildings are also used in the healthcare industry, as they can be designed to meet the specific needs of hospitals and clinics.

In the residential sector, modular buildings are becoming increasingly popular as a cost-effective and efficient alternative to traditional construction methods. Modular homes are designed to be customisable, and can be built to meet the specific needs of the client. They are also energy-efficient, and can be designed to be environmentally sustainable.
